数据库箭头是什么意思呀
-
数据库箭头是指在数据库设计中用于表示关系的符号。它是一个带有方向的箭头,用于连接两个表,表示表之间的关系。数据库箭头通常有两种类型:一对一关系和一对多关系。
-
一对一关系:当两个表之间存在一对一关系时,可以使用一个箭头连接这两个表。这表示每个记录在一个表中只有一个对应的记录在另一个表中,而且每个记录在另一个表中也只有一个对应的记录。例如,一个人可以与一个身份证号码对应,一个身份证号码也只能对应一个人。
-
一对多关系:当一个表的记录可以对应多个另一个表的记录时,可以使用一个箭头从一个表指向另一个表。这表示一个记录在一个表中有多个对应的记录在另一个表中。例如,一个部门可以有多个员工,但每个员工只属于一个部门。
-
箭头方向的含义:箭头的方向表示了关系的方向。箭头从一个表指向另一个表,表示关系的从属方向。例如,如果箭头从员工表指向部门表,表示员工从属于部门。反之,如果箭头从部门表指向员工表,表示部门拥有员工。
-
外键约束:数据库箭头通常与外键约束一起使用。外键是一个字段,它与另一个表的主键建立了关联。使用箭头可以直观地表示外键关系,帮助开发人员更好地理解数据库结构。
-
数据库设计工具:在数据库设计中,可以使用专门的数据库设计工具来绘制箭头表示的关系。这些工具提供了丰富的符号和选项,可以帮助开发人员创建和管理数据库结构。
总之,数据库箭头是表示数据库表之间关系的符号,通过箭头的方向和形式,可以直观地展示表之间的关联关系,帮助开发人员理解数据库结构。
1年前 -
-
数据库箭头是指在数据库中用来表示关系的箭头符号。箭头的方向表示两个实体之间的关系。在关系型数据库中,箭头通常用来表示外键关系。
外键是一种用来建立表与表之间关系的机制,它通过指定一个列或一组列,将一个表中的数据与另一个表中的数据关联起来。在关系型数据库中,外键通常由箭头符号表示,箭头指向被关联的表。
箭头的方向通常是从关联表(外键表)指向被关联表(主键表)。这表示关联表中的外键列引用了被关联表中的主键列。通过这种方式,可以实现多个表之间的关联,从而建立起数据库中的关系。
数据库箭头的意义在于帮助开发者和数据库管理员理解和维护数据库中的关系。通过箭头的方向,可以清晰地了解哪些表之间存在关联,哪些列被其他表引用等。这对于数据库的设计、查询和维护都非常重要。
总之,数据库箭头是用来表示关系的符号,通过箭头的方向来表示表之间的关联关系,帮助开发者和数据库管理员理解和管理数据库中的关系。
1年前 -
数据库箭头是指在数据库设计中,用于表示两个实体之间的关系的箭头符号。它用于表示实体之间的联系和依赖关系,帮助我们理解和描述实体之间的连接方式。
数据库箭头主要有三种类型:一对一关系、一对多关系和多对多关系。
-
一对一关系(One-to-One):一对一关系表示一个实体与另一个实体之间存在唯一的对应关系。在数据库设计中,一对一关系的箭头通常从拥有外键的实体指向被引用的实体。例如,在一个学生和身份证号之间的关系中,一个学生只能对应一个身份证号,而一个身份证号也只能对应一个学生。
-
一对多关系(One-to-Many):一对多关系表示一个实体与另一个实体之间存在一对多的关系。在数据库设计中,一对多关系的箭头通常从拥有外键的实体指向被引用的实体。例如,在一个部门和员工之间的关系中,一个部门可以有多个员工,而一个员工只能属于一个部门。
-
多对多关系(Many-to-Many):多对多关系表示一个实体与另一个实体之间存在多对多的关系。在数据库设计中,多对多关系无法直接表示,需要通过引入第三张关系表来实现。例如,在一个学生和课程之间的关系中,一个学生可以选择多个课程,而一个课程也可以被多个学生选择。
在数据库设计中,正确使用数据库箭头可以帮助我们准确地描述实体之间的关系,从而提高数据库的设计和查询效率。在创建数据库表时,我们可以根据实际需求选择适当的关系类型,并使用箭头符号来表示这些关系,以便更好地理解和管理数据库。
1年前 -